[17] Early in the morning of Christmas Eve, the head of the family would go to a forest to cut badnjak, a young oak, the oak tree would then be brought into the church to be blessed by the priest. There is more than one reason why many avoided declaring themselves Serbs. The complexity of Yugoslavia, mixed marriages, status that Serbs had in the media during the last 30 years are definitely at the top of the list. [8] Serb immigrants first came in significant numbers to the United States in the late 19th century from the Adriatic regions of Austria-Hungary and areas of the Balkans.
